How much do weekend machine operator j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 12, 2026, the average hourly pay for weekend machine operator in Batavia, IL is $18.54,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$16.68 and $19.86 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a weekend machine operator?

Weekend Machine Operators are skilled workers responsible for operating and monitoring machinery in manufacturing or production facilities specifically during weekend shifts. Their duties typically include setting up machines, inspecting products for quality, troubleshooting equipment issues, and ensuring production goals are met while maintaining safety standards. This role is crucial for companies that run operations seven days a week, as it helps maintain continuous productivity and meet customer demands. Weekend Machine Operators often work part-time or full-time hours exclusively on Saturdays and Sundays, and may receive higher pay rates due to non-standard hours.

What does a weekend machine operator's typical schedule look like, and how does it impact work-life balance?

Weekend Machine Operators typically work extended shifts on Fridays, Saturdays, and Sundays, often covering 12-hour shifts to maximize output during peak production periods. This concentrated schedule can free up weekdays for personal activities, but it also requires stamina and adaptability to maintain performance during longer work periods. Teamwork is crucial, as operators often coordinate handoffs with weekday staff and collaborate closely with technicians and quality control teams to ensure smooth operations. While the role offers unique scheduling flexibility, managing fatigue and maintaining focus over long shifts are common challenges.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a weekend machine operator,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Weekend Machine Operator, you typically need a high school diploma or equivalent, mechanical aptitude, and experience operating industrial machinery. Familiarity with manufacturing equipment, safety protocols, and basic computer systems like PLCs or production tracking software is usually required. Attention to detail, problem-solving skills, and reliability are crucial soft skills for this role. These abilities ensure efficient operation, minimize downtime, and help maintain a safe, productive manufacturing environment.

Swiss CNC Machine Operator

The Swiss CNC Machine Operator produces custom precision parts by operating a multi-axis CNC Swiss-Style machine. Maintains quality and safety standards, keeping records and maintaining equipment and supplies.

Responsibilities

Responsibilities will include but not be limited to the following:

  • Responsible for the operation of multiple machines throughout the shift and producing parts within required tolerances.
  • Responsible for inspection of precision product utilizing various precision measuring equipment and visual inspection.
  • Make offset adjustments, sharpen tooling, change tooling, adjust tooling, and maintain machine fluid levels.
  • Operate and load bar feeder and measure bar stock material.
  • Check material to ensure correct material is used per blueprint and job specifications.
  • Knowledge of various material and differences between each.
  • Maintain equipment by completing preventative maintenance requirements and maintaining a clean and safe workstation.
  • Communication with set-up person, supervisors, foreman, and other shifts regarding the quality and job status.
  • Verify machine cycle time, speak with set-up person if router cycle time cannot be met.
  • Document in-process inspection as required.
  • Train personnel as required.
  • Address issues in a positive manner.
  • Performs other work-related activities as assigned by the line supervisor, supervisor, or foreman.

Position Requirements

  • Requires visual acuity (corrected) to read directions, interpret blueprints, and to inspect precision machined parts closely to ensure that they meet specifications.
  • Manual dexterity sufficient to operate machinery for precision work.
  • Physical ability to work requiring continuous standing, bending, twisting, and stooping the entire shift.
  • Physical strength to lift and carry up to 50lbs. frequently throughout the day.
  • One year experience operating CNC Swiss-style machines (Citizen, Tornos, Deco, or Star)
  • Ability to keep multiple CNC machines operational making quality product. 
  • Possess mathematical abilities, verbal/written communication.
  • Understanding of ISO: 9001, ISO: 13485.
  • Basic GD&T understanding.
  • Ability to read and understand blueprints. 
  • Ability to accurately use precision gauges and visual accuracy.
  • Ability to produce precision work in a production environment.
